Understanding HTTPS Adoption in Search: From 50% to Near-Universal

How the Moz report revealed Google's push for web security and what it means for modern web development with Next.js

The Moz Report: A Turning Point for Web Security

In April 2017, Moz announced a milestone that would reshape the web: 50% of page-one Google results were now HTTPS. This finding, based on tracking 10,000 keywords through their MozCast dataset, revealed how effectively Google's quiet pressure campaign had worked. Just nine months earlier, that number had been only 30%. The growth was steady, consistent, and driven not by algorithm updates but by the industry's recognition that security was becoming essential.

The data was independently confirmed by Rank Ranger, which operated a completely separate tracking system. When two independent datasets reach the same conclusion, the pattern is real. What followed was an acceleration that surprised even optimistic observers--by late 2022, HTTPS had reached 99% prevalence in page-one results. The web had fundamentally shifted.

Moz's 2017 HTTPS report marked a turning point where security transitioned from optional enhancement to baseline requirement. For modern web development projects, this evolution means HTTPS implementation is no longer a consideration--it's simply expected as part of any professional deployment. Developers implementing OAuth 2.0 authentication in their applications will find that HTTPS is a mandatory foundation for secure token handling.

The Evolution of HTTPS Adoption

8%

2014 - HTTPS adoption when Google announced ranking boost

30%

2016 - Growth before the Moz report

50%

April 2017 - Moz report milestone

99%

2022 - Near-universal adoption

Implementing HTTPS in Modern Web Development

For developers building with modern frameworks, HTTPS is no longer a complicated infrastructure project. Platforms like Vercel and Netlify provide automatic HTTPS for custom domains, handling certificate issuance, renewal, and configuration without intervention. Let's Encrypt has democratized SSL certificates, making them free and automated.

For Next.js applications, HTTPS is typically transparent. The framework and its hosting platforms handle the complexity, but understanding the underlying mechanisms helps when troubleshooting edge cases or working with custom deployments. Following Node.js logging best practices ensures you capture certificate renewal events and security-related logs in your monitoring systems.

Next.js HTTPS Configuration

While HTTPS is automatic on managed platforms, understanding the configuration options ensures your application maximizes security headers and handles edge cases correctly. Our Next.js development services ensure your applications are configured with optimal security settings from the start.

next.config.js - Security Headers for HTTPS
1module.exports = {2 async headers() {3 return [4 {5 source: '/(.*)',6 headers: [7 {8 key: 'Strict-Transport-Security',9 value: 'max-age=31536000; includeSubDomains; preload'10 },11 {12 key: 'X-Content-Type-Options',13 value: 'nosniff'14 },15 {16 key: 'X-Frame-Options',17 value: 'DENY'18 },19 {20 key: 'Referrer-Policy',21 value: 'strict-origin-when-cross-origin'22 }23 ]24 }25 ]26 }27}

SSL/TLS Certificate Options

Understanding certificate types helps when architecting multi-domain systems or planning certificate management at scale.

Certificate TypeUse CaseCostValidationRenewal
Domain Validation (DV)Basic sites, blogsFree (Let's Encrypt)Automated90 days
Organization Validation (OV)Business sitesPaidBusiness verification1 year
Extended Validation (EV)E-commerce, enterprisePremiumExtensive vetting1 year
WildcardMultiple subdomainsPaidDomain validation1 year

Let's Encrypt has transformed the landscape by making DV certificates free and automated through ACME (Automated Certificate Management Environment). For most web applications, DV certificates provide identical encryption strength to premium options.

For enterprise deployments with many domains, tools like cert-manager (Kubernetes) or automated scripts with Let's Encrypt automate the entire certificate lifecycle. When planning your technology stack, consider how certificate management integrates with your deployment pipeline. Implementing robust job scheduling for certificate renewal ensures your certificates never expire unexpectedly.

Performance Considerations

The myth that HTTPS slows down websites was true in the early days of TLS 1.0 and 1.1. Modern web infrastructure has eliminated this concern. TLS 1.3, the current standard, reduces the handshake from two round trips to one, actually improving latency compared to the older TLS 1.2 handshake.

TLS 1.3 Advantages

  • 1-RTT handshake: Single round trip vs. 2-RTT in TLS 1.2
  • 0-RTT for returning visitors: Even faster for repeat connections
  • Modern cipher suites: Better performance, stronger security
  • No legacy algorithms: Removed insecure options by default

HTTP/2 and HTTP/3, which require HTTPS, provide additional performance benefits through multiplexing, header compression, and server push. These protocols actually make HTTPS-enabled sites faster than their HTTP counterparts. Optimizing Core Web Vitals is directly connected to modern protocol adoption.

The performance narrative has completely inverted--HTTPS is now a prerequisite for accessing modern web performance features. Leveraging the latest TypeScript 5 features in your build configuration can help you take advantage of these modern protocols with better type safety.

Security Benefits Beyond Encryption

HTTPS enables critical security features that protect users and data

Data Integrity

Prevents man-in-the-middle attacks and content modification

Authentication

Verifies you're connecting to the intended server

HSTS Support

HTTP Strict Transport Security prevents downgrade attacks

Modern Browser Features

Service workers, geolocation, and PWA features require HTTPS

Migration Challenges and Solutions

The sites that delayed HTTPS migration in 2017--companies like eBay, Target, Best Buy, and WebMD--faced legitimate challenges. Large-scale migrations on legacy platforms created complex redirect chains, mixed content issues, and SEO volatility concerns.

Common Migration Pitfalls

  1. Mixed Content: Assets (images, scripts, stylesheets) still loading over HTTP break security indicators and trigger browser warnings
  2. Redirect Chains: Multiple 301 redirects before reaching the final HTTPS URL waste crawl budget and slow users
  3. Canonical Tags: Incorrect canonical pointing to HTTP version signals search engines to index the insecure URL
  4. Certificate Errors: Expired certificates or misconfigured chains trigger security warnings

Migration Best Practices

  • Audit all external resources and update them to protocol-relative or HTTPS URLs
  • Implement 301 redirects directly from HTTP to HTTPS in a single hop
  • Update canonical tags to point to HTTPS versions before migrating
  • Use HSTS headers to prevent downgrade attacks after migration
  • Preload your domain in browser HSTS preload lists for maximum protection
  • Monitor search console for crawl errors and indexing issues post-migration

For modern Next.js applications, these concerns are largely historical. The framework's deployment platforms handle HTTPS automatically, and modern build tooling catches mixed content issues during development. Our technical SEO services ensure migrations preserve your search rankings. Implementing comprehensive keyboard-navigable widgets alongside HTTPS ensures your site is both accessible and secure.

HTTPS as Baseline: The New Reality

The Moz report's 50% milestone feels like ancient history in web years. Today, HTTPS is not a competitive advantage--it's a baseline expectation. New projects that don't implement HTTPS are DOA (dead on arrival) for professional deployment.

The implications for web developers are straightforward: HTTPS is now table stakes. Modern frameworks and hosting platforms make implementation trivial, while the security, performance, and trust benefits are substantial. The debate over whether to use HTTPS ended years ago.

What the Moz data really showed was Google's ability to reshape web standards through quiet pressure rather than aggressive mandates. The industry responded not because of ranking penalties, but because security became a competitive necessity. Today, we build with HTTPS by default--and that's exactly how it should be. Partner with our web development team to ensure your projects implement security best practices from day one.

Ready to Build Secure, High-Performance Web Applications?

We create modern websites with security, performance, and SEO built-in from the start.

Frequently Asked Questions